RE: Is it that great?
I have bought two of them, my brother has one now. Its extremely flat, and very accurate in a decent gun. And explosive on groundhogs. Now the bad. I can't get mine to shoot 40gr or higher bullets well at all. I think it would take a tighter twist. I would rather have a 22-250 after its all said and done. But I am keeping mine. Its fun. I can littlerly watch the impact thru my scope.
